Understanding the "Eco-Friendly Crypto Mining Alternative"

At its core, PepeNode is proposing an alternative to traditional cryptocurrency mining. Conventional mining, particularly for proof-of-work blockchains like Bitcoin, requires vast amounts of computational power and electricity to solve complex mathematical problems and validate transactions. This process, while secure, has drawn widespread criticism for its carbon footprint. PepeNode's model diverges from this energy-intensive path. The project is building infrastructure that allows users to participate in network validation and earn rewards through mechanisms that are inherently less energy-dependent. While the technical specifics of whether it utilizes a proof-of-stake (PoS) model, delegated proof-of-stake (DPoS), or another consensus mechanism are not detailed in the announcement, the overarching goal is clear: to drastically reduce the environmental impact associated with securing a blockchain network.

Contextualizing the Green Shift: From Proof-of-Work to Sustainable Consensus

To fully appreciate PepeNode's proposition, it is essential to understand the historical context of blockchain consensus mechanisms. The launch of Bitcoin in 2009 introduced proof-of-work (PoW) as the foundational security model for decentralized networks. For years, PoW was the undisputed standard. However, as networks grew, so did their energy appetites. By 2021, public awareness of Bitcoin's energy usage, often compared to that of small countries, reached a fever pitch, sparking intense debate and pushing sustainability to the top of the industry's agenda.

This pressure catalyzed a monumental shift, most notably exemplified by Ethereum's "Merge" in September 2022. Ethereum transitioned from a proof-of-work to a proof-of-stake consensus mechanism, an event that slashed its energy consumption by an estimated 99.9%. This successful transition served as a powerful proof-of-concept for the entire industry, demonstrating that major blockchain networks could operate securely without exorbitant energy costs.
